* Orthotrichus umtalianum (Péringuey, 1904)

Distribution in Angola (Provinces): 2) Kwanza Sul, Malanje.

Material examined. Cambamba (Catoio-Quela) (09° 14´42´´ S, 17° 00´33´´ E, 1178 m alt., 115) (MALANJE), 20.XI.2015, 1♂, 1♀, DO, A. Serrano & R. Capela leg., ASC; Calulo (Faz. Klein) (10° 02´14´´ S, 14° 54´38´´ E, 1059 m alt., 147) (KWANZA SUL), 1.XII.2015, 1♂, DO, A. Serrano & R. Capela leg., ASC .

Remarks. A species known from central, southern and part of eastern Africa (D. R. of the Congo, Souh Africa R., Burundi, Zimbabwe) (Basilewsky 1950b, Insectoid.info 2017). Adults fit very well its description, including the aedeagus features (Péringuey 1904, Basilewsky 1950b). Adult specimens were found within litter in an open secondary forest and in a secondary rainforest together with some other tiger and ground beetles (see S. vilhenai and O. gilvipes remarks for first and second localities, respectively). It is a new species record for Angola.
